30 Million Tonnes of Oil Produced at LUKOIL’s Vladimir Filanovsky Field in the Caspian Sea

LUKOIL’s oil production at its Caspian Vladimir Filanovsky field exceeded 30 million tonnes. In 2021, the field saw 5 development wells built (including 4 production wells and 1 injection well) to maintain the plateau level of 6 million tonnes of oil per year. BP: Drills Second Exploration Well in Shallow Waters of the Absheron Archipelago

BP has started drilling a second exploration well in the shallow waters of the Absheron archipelago in the Azerbaijani sector of the Caspian Sea. The works are carried out using the Satti jack-up floating drilling rig. TATNEFT: Was the First in Russia to Receive an Electronic Integrated Environmental Permit

The integrated environmental permit in the electronic format (IEP) was obtained by the Yamashneft Oil and Gas Production Division (NGDU). The integrated environmental permit contains the entire list of necessary and mandatory requirements in the field of environmental protection for a particular enterprise.
